The Bhanupratappur constituency witnessed an interesting fight in the 2023 assembly election. The voters exercised their voting franchise and 81% of voting was recorded in this constituency..

| Year | Candidate's Name | Votes | Lead | Vote Share |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2023 | Smt. Savitri Mandavi | INC | 83,931 | 30,932 | 50.63% |
| 2022-By Election | Savitri Manoj Mandavi | INC | 65,479 | 21,171 | 44.88% |
| 2018 | Manoj Singh Mandavi | INC | 72,520 | 26,693 | 49% |
| 2013 | Manoj Singh Mandavi | INC | 64,837 | 14,896 | 48% |
| 2008 | Bramhanand | BJP | 41,384 | 15,479 | 38% |
| 2003 | Deolal Dugga | BJP | 40,803 | 621 | 39% |

Smt. Savitri Mandavi of the Indian National Congress (INC) won the Bhanupratappur Assembly seat in the 2023 elections, defeating Gautam Uikey of the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) by a margin of 30932 votes.
The strike rate in the Bhanupratappur constituency is 67% INC and 33% BJP, with INC won 4 times and BJP won 2 times since the 2003 elections.
